Hello - actually there are more and more heater blocks available with support for dual heater cartridges and dual pt100 (or other thermistor) slots.
One example is the mosquitto plus, designed for two 50W heater elements and two pt1000.
I was wondering, that the firmware of the duet3d has no valid workaround for powering these cartridges from the two heater ports of the Duet2Ethernet. The PWM for booth MOSFets could be driven from the output of a single PID controller. The temperature from one PT1000 for controlling could be enough and the second could PT1000 could be used for safety e.g. the inputs are not allowed to differ more than X degree...
I am not a specialist in commissioning the duet3d hardware, but after a short research of the possibilities offered by the manual and the wiki I think there is no solution for running two MOSFet channels in parallel.
Physically I can connect booth cartridges in parallel, giving me a resistance of 6 Ohm - so 4Amps @24VDC should be OK for that type of transistor - but perhaps there is another solution or a road-map for a future release maybe implementing this feature..?!
